比特币挖矿软件是指那些用于参与比特币网络中“挖矿”过程的计算机程序或工具。从技术角度讲,挖矿是通过解决复杂的数学问题来验证交易并形成新的区块的过程,在这个过程中会产生新铸造的比特币作为奖励给成功完成任务的人(即矿工)。因此,可以将比特币挖矿软件理解为帮助用户执行这种特定计算工作以赚取加密货币的工具。
比特币挖矿的工作原理
在区块链技术的应用场景下,尤其是对于采用“工作量证明”机制的比特币网络来说,挖矿不仅是获取新发行代币的方式,更是维护和保护整个系统安全稳定的关键。这一过程要求参与者(即矿工)不断尝试不同的哈希值组合来找到一个符合条件的新区块头,直到成功为止。为了提高效率和竞争力,矿工会使用专门设计的硬件设备如ASIC(专用集成电路)搭配特定的挖矿软件来进行操作。
比特币挖矿软件的功能
- **连接节点**:与比特币网络中的其他参与者建立联系。
- **解决算法问题**:执行复杂的数学运算以验证交易记录。
- **监控性能**:显示当前系统的算力、温度等信息并允许调整设置来优化挖掘效率。
- **管理钱包地址**:帮助用户接收他们通过挖矿获得的比特币。
如何选择合适的挖矿软件?
当考虑加入比特币挖矿活动时,选择适合自身硬件条件及需求的软件非常重要。市场上存在多种类型的开源或商业化的挖矿程序,其中一些较为知名的产品包括:
- **BFGMiner**
- **CGMiner**
- **BTCMiner**
每款都有其特点和优势,在做出决定前最好仔细研究各个选项的功能特性,并考虑到个人设备的具体情况。
总之,比特币挖矿软件是实现区块链中“工作量证明”机制不可或缺的一部分。它不仅代表了用户参与数字货币经济体系的一个途径,同时也象征着对维护网络安全贡献的认可与奖励。